The Ekiti State Governor Biodun Oyebanji has lauded the patriotism of the men and officers of the Nigerian Army, saying their sense of commitment to national duties saved Nigeria from drifting into anarchy and protecting the country’s territorial integrity.

Advertisement

The governor posited that it was in recognition of this onerous duty that the Ekiti state government, under his watch, donated a whopping sum of N10 million to support the war veterans, in addition to the personal donation he made for the upkeep of those who fought to protect Nigeria’s sovereignty.

Oyebanji spoke in Ado Ekiti on Wednesday during a programme commemorating the 2025 Armed Forces Remembrance Day held at the Ekitiparapo Pavilion in the Ekiti State Capital.

The event featured wreath laying, which was performed by the Governor, Speaker of the Ekiti Assembly, Hon Adeoye Aribasoye, representative of the 32 Artillery Brigade Commander, Major Gen Imam Babakura, Police Commissioner, Mr. Joseph Eribo, the Ewi of Ado Ekiti, Oba Rufus Adeyemo Adejugbe, and other high-profile dignitaries.

Addressing the war veterans and soldiers, Oyebanji, represented by the Deputy Governor, Chief (Mrs) Monisade Afuye, said Nigeria could have been plunged into ebullition through the horrendous activities of insurgents, bandits, and kidnappers, but for the efficiency of the Nigerian military, which deployed its strength to avert such a sordid scenario.

Oyebanji profoundly thanked the military for partnering with other security networks to make Ekiti safe for habitation and investments, assuring that his administration would work hard to cement the bond of unity among the security outfits in the state.

He commended those who lost their lives in the course of fighting for the nation and those who are still on the battlefields to restore normalcy to all the beleaguered areas.

In an extreme exhibition of empathy, Oyebanji urged Nigerians to pay tremendous respect and support the families of those in these categories in the spirit of brotherhood and patriotism.

ADVERTISEMENT

“Let me seize this opportunity to especially commend the immense contributions of the military in Ekiti State to the relative peace we enjoy in Ekiti State. Without your efforts, society could have been in a state of anarchy.

“Your sleeplessness, restlessness and commitment are the reasons we can all go about our daily businesses with the conviction of coming back unhurt.’’
